摘要
The mechanical behaviour of BaFCl single crystals has been investigated by use of Vickers microindentation. The tests performed on (001) and (100) planes show an important hardness anisotropy, higher values being obtained on (100) planes and all being close to that of BaF2. A qualitative investigation of the impressions has established the occurrence of cleavage along {100} planes, whereas slip occurs much more easily along (001) planes. For tests performed on the (001) plane, a quantitative analysis of the indentation cracks yields a very low toughness value. On comparing the BaFCl and BaF2 structures, it is concluded that the chlorine layers introduce a marked anisotropy but do not have the expected weakening effect.
